Macronutrients and Vitamins in "Pie Crust Standard-Type Frozen Ready-To-Bake Unenriched"
Food Name: Pie Crust Standard-Type Frozen Ready-To-Bake Unenriched | |
Food Group: Baked Foods | |
Macronutrients | |
Calories (kcal): 457 | Total Fat (g): 29 |
Protein (g): 4 | Carbohydrates (g): 44 |
Fiber (g): 1 | Net Carbs (g): 43 |
Water (g): 21 | |
Fats | |
Saturated Fat (g): 4 | Monounsaturated Fat (mg): 12414 |
Polyunsaturated Fat (mg): 11000 | Omega-3 (mg): 759 |
Omega-6 (mg): 10212 | |
Vitamins | |
Niacin/B3 (mg): 1 | Folate/B9 (mcg): 10 |
Food Folate (mcg): 10 | Folate DFE (mcg): 10 |
Minerals | |
Calcium (mg): 18 | Magnesium (mg): 16 |
Phosphorus (mg): 53 | Potassium (mg): 98 |
Sodium (mg): 576 | Manganese (mg): 1 |
Amino Acids | |
Tryptophan (mg): 56 | Threonine (mg): 112 |
Isoleucine (mg): 150 | Leucine (mg): 267 |
Lysine (mg): 140 | Methionine (mg): 65 |
Cystine (mg): 85 | Phenylalanine (mg): 182 |
Tyrosine (mg): 111 | Valine (mg): 172 |
Arginine (mg): 148 | Histidine (mg): 79 |
Alanine (mg): 119 | Aspartic Acid (mg): 169 |
Glutamic Acid (mg): 1266 | Glycine (mg): 131 |
Proline (mg): 427 | Serine (mg): 205 |

What are the protein, carbohydrate, and fat contents in 100 grams of 'Pie Crust Standard-Type Frozen Ready-To-Bake Unenriched'?
100 grams of 'Pie Crust Standard-Type Frozen Ready-To-Bake Unenriched' contains approximately following amounts of protein, carbohydrates, and fat:
Protein – 4g (around 8% of daily requirement),
Carbohydrates – 44g (around 16% of daily requirement),
Fat – 29g (around 37% of daily requirement).
It is typically higher in Carbohydrates while lower in Protein, making it more suitable for diets that are high-carb and also suitable for those requiring low Protein intake.
How many calories are in 100 grams of 'Pie Crust Standard-Type Frozen Ready-To-Bake Unenriched'?
A 100-gram serving of 'Pie Crust Standard-Type Frozen Ready-To-Bake Unenriched' provides around 457 kcal of energy. The majority of the calories come from fat, based on its macronutrient composition. This contributes approximately 23% of an average 2000 kcal daily diet, making it a calorie-dense food choice.
